WebThe sponsor and their parents or grandparents must then pay application fees. This includes the following: Sponsorship fees: $75 CAD. Processing fees for each parent or grandparent: $490. Right of permanent residence fees for each parent or grandparent: $515 CAD. Biometrics fees per parent or grandparent: $85 CAD. WebOct 12, 2024 · Third, Canada imposes a 20-year undertaking period on those who sponsor their parents and grandparents. This means that sponsors sign a contract with the Canadian government that they will be financially responsible for their parents and grandparents for 20 years from the date their family member obtains permanent residence.
